From: Marcus Cooper <redacted> The BCLKDIV and MCLKDIV found on newer SoCs start from an offset of 1. Add the functionality to adjust the division values according to the needs to the device being used. Signed-off-by: Marcus Cooper <redacted> --- sound/soc/sunxi/sun4i-i2s.c | 8 ++++++-- 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)diff --git a/sound/soc/sunxi/sun4i-i2s.c b/sound/soc/sunxi/sun4i-i2s.c index d7ee7a443e4e..1d538de4e4d0 100644 --- a/sound/soc/sunxi/sun4i-i2s.c +++ b/sound/soc/sunxi/sun4i-i2s.c@@ -94,9 +94,13 @@ * struct sun4i_i2s_quirks - Differences between SoC variants. * * @has_reset: SoC needs reset deasserted. + * @mclk_offset: Value by which mclkdiv needs to be adjusted. + * @bclk_offset: Value by which bclkdiv needs to be adjusted. */ struct sun4i_i2s_quirks { bool has_reset; + unsigned int mclk_offset; + unsigned int bclk_offset; }; struct sun4i_i2s {@@ -149,7 +153,7 @@ static int sun4i_i2s_get_bclk_div(struct sun4i_i2s *i2s, const struct sun4i_i2s_clk_div *bdiv = &sun4i_i2s_bclk_div[i]; if (bdiv->div == div) - return bdiv->val; + return bdiv->val + i2s->variant->bclk_offset;
The offset should best be applied when the value is written to the register, in sun4i_i2s_set_clk_rate(). sun4i_i2s_get_*_div() should do what the name says, that is calculate a divider based on the parameters it is given. Regards ChenYu
